Kolkata Police Summon TMC Leaders Over Camac Street Office Scuffle
Kolkata Police have issued summons to former TMC MLA Humayun Kabir and others, including TMC leaders Abhishek Banerjee and Derek O'Brien, in connection with a scuffle at Banerjee's Camac Street office during the removal of a billboard bearing Trinamool Congress signage. The police allege obstruction of government officials and unlawful assembly. TMC leaders deny allegations of heckling police, describing the notice as illegal. Fourteen arrests have been made, and investigations continue with multiple FIRs filed.
